Window sill to sit on
If you dream of a niche by the window as a seat, there are three optionsidyllic ideato realize: a bay window as an integral part of the architecture, a window niche through custom-made conversions that can also be used as storage space or a piece of lounge furniture fitted under the window front. The important thing here is that you have to have a seat width of at least 40 centimeters. Cozy cushions and seat cushions can also be placed to create a pleasant, cozy atmosphere. You should also think about highly thermally insulated windows that ensure an optimal room temperature.
Wide walls with a window that is flush with the facade are particularly suitable for a window sill for sitting. This creates deep window niches that can be wonderfully fitted with a panel made of wood, stone or concrete. ABay window
Since the Renaissance, bay windows have been considered a status symbol and a stylistic element that visually enhances the facade. Most of the time they were purely decorative, to visually enlarge the room and let in more light. Usually they were in two parts and rarely in three parts. The so-called “bay windows” are a constant in English building culture. Bay windows are not losing their popularity in contemporary architecture. In connection with the straight proportions of the buildings and their minimalist character, they now have a distinctly rectangular shape.
Advantages ofBay window
Bay windows extend the viewing angle from 45 to 270 degrees and thereby optimize the incidence of light. This makes the interior look larger and more open. These characteristics and the use of more glass in new buildings make the installation of bay windows as a style element increasingly popular. They also enable a diverse, stylistic design. Most often they serve as a cozy component that enhances the design of the home, for example a window sill to sit on.
The biggest problem when installing bay windows and generally large glass surfaces is energy efficiency. In new buildings that combine a modern lifestyle with well-thought-out, open spatial planning and contemporary architecture, large-format box windows are particularly preferred. Thanks to their insulating space, they not only ensure optimal sound and insulation protection, but are also a popular style element.
window sillfor theInstall seats
A challenge when installing a wider window sill for sitting can be the radiators, which are usually found under the windows in old apartments, but not only. If these are covered, they provide significantly less heating output in winter. Installing a window sill is only advisable if there is another form of heating in the room, such as underfloor, infrared or wall heating.
A window sill that is wide enough to sit on can be built in the form of a window-high shelf. It would be particularly practical if there was storage space under the seat. If you want to put a foam mat on it for comfortable sitting, then you also have to plan for its thickness so that there are no problems when opening the window.
Window sill to sit ononemodernLiving space design
Modern living space design includes large window areas, which are the perfect starting point for deep window niches. If these are available, they can be used as a comfortable seat and transformed into a so-called seat window. This is the perfect place in the apartment to relax and can quickly become a favorite place for the whole family.
Windows facing the street are not particularly suitable. The noise and constant movement of people and means of transport are disruptive. Plus, not everyone wants to sit in a display. The seat window is best oriented towards a courtyard or garden and thus offers a quiet view.
Wooden variants
It is best to make a window sill for sitting out of wood. In contrast to stone or similar, this material impresses with a warm look and is also characterized by optimal thermal insulation properties. Wooden windows can absorb and release moisture, which contributes to a very good indoor climate. In contrast to plastic, the natural wood material does not become statically charged and does not collect as much dust in the corners. Finally, cleaning is made easier.
Window sill to sit onout ofNatural or artificial stone
A window sill for sitting made of natural or artificial stone fits particularly well into a modern living environment. The material offers a very wide variety of colors and structures. But it's not just its visual properties that impress. From a purely technical perspective, stone window sills can be easily and precisely adjusted to create a better seal between the facade and the window. Artificial stones are particularly suitable for indoor use and are also cheaper than this natural type.
window sillfor theGranite seats
Whether granite, marble or another natural stone, the sustainable material promises lasting enjoyment of the object. The robust look combines very well with plastic, aluminum or steel, which the window frames and patio doors are usually made of. A few soft cushions and a padded seat mat soften the appearance and ensure a high level of comfort when sitting comfortably and looking out.
window sill toSitmade of concrete
Concrete window benches are an inseparable part of the currently very current industrial style. They are made to measure and can therefore fully meet individual ideas and requirements. In addition, they are characterized by high durability and minimalist aesthetics. The material can also be tinted and thus adapted to any living environment.

Totransform into a reading corner
If the location and orientation of the window is particularly advantageous, you can create a cozy reading corner. Sufficient lighting, but not blinding, is required, especially in the evening or when there is not enough daylight. Reading lights that can be mounted on the wall are perhaps the best solution here because they hardly require any space to install. A floor lamp is of course always a flexible alternative.
